Silwerskerm Awards: First winners announced

The first half of the Silwerskerm Awards for Film and TV took place on Saturday morning (23 August) at The Bay Hotel in Camps Bay.

Winners were announced in the following categories:

  • Technical categories across all genres
  • Short film and documentary categories
  • Selected feature film categories

At this event, Marida Swanepoel – a founding member of kykNET, among other achievements – was also honoured for her lifetime contribution.

The winners in the categories for best feature film, as well as for best actors and supporting actors in a feature film will be announced on Saturday evening at the glamorous awards ceremony in the Cape Town International Convention Centre (CTICC).

THE WINNERS IN SOME OF THE FEATURE FILM CATEGORIES:

 

Best Screenplay

Nico Scheepers – Hen

 

Best Original Score

Tapiwa Musvosvi – The Heart Is a Muscle

 

Best Sound Design

Tim Pringle – Hen

 

Best Cinematography

Chris Lotz – Hen

 

Best Editing

Regardt Botha – Hen

 

Best Makeup and Hair

Jolene Cilliers – Hen

 

Best Costume Design

Sulet Meintjes – Hen

 

Best Production Design

Sumaya Wicomb – Finding Optel

 

Best Director

Nico Scheepers – Hen

THE WINNERS IN THE SHORT FILM CATEGORIES  FOR RISING AND ESTABLISHED FILMMAKERS:

 

Best Script in a Short Film by a Rising Filmmaker

Anél Wood – Min of Meer

 

Best Directing in a Short Film by a Rising Filmmaker

Cindy Swanepoel – Min of Meer

Best Short Film by a Rising Filmmaker

Min of Meer

 

Best Cinematography in a Short Film

Chris Lotz – Hier

Best Editing in a Short Film

Regardt Visser – Totsiens, Selina

 

Best Actor in a Short Film

David Viviers – Hier

 

Best Actress in a Short Film

Liezl de Kock – Min of Meer

 

Best Short Film by an Established Filmmaker

Totsiens, Selina

THE WINNERS IN THE DOCUMENTARY CATEGORIES:

 

Best Directing in a Short Documentary

Danielle McDonald – Vet vannie land

 

Best Editing in a Short Documentary

Jurg Slabbert – Vet vannie land

 

Best Short Documentary

Vet vannie land
